How to Remove All Transformations in OBJ in Blender

Oct 01, 2024

Do you work with 3D models in Blender and need to remove all transformations in an OBJ file? This tutorial will guide you through the process of resetting the position, rotation, and scale of your object to ensure a clean and uniform appearance. Follow these steps to remove all transformations in Blender:

1. Open your OBJ file in Blender by navigating to File > Import > Wavefront (.obj).

2. Once the OBJ file is imported, select the object by right-clicking on it in the 3D Viewport.

3. Press 'Ctrl + A' and select 'Apply All Transforms' from the menu. This action will reset the object's position, rotation, and scale to their original state.

4. Finally, export the cleaned OBJ file by going to File > Export > Wavefront (.obj) and save it with a new name to preserve the original file.

By following these steps, you can remove all transformations in an OBJ file and ensure that your 3D models appear as intended without any unintended changes.
